This is show is all about helping Black Professionals start purpose/passion projects so that they can expand their impact in the world. I’ll have interview episodes and solo episodes all with the goal of providing you with the examples and tools you need to get and keep going on your purpose/passion project journey. Our special guest today is Odie Miller. You will hear him share his purpose/passion project, "ODM Productions."
There is so much goodness in this episode from how Odie built his own music and video production studio in a 40 foot shipping container over 5 years, to his advice to those on the fence with their own projects. He is a true craftsman and it comes out in this episode.
